6. Data Retention
We retain your personal data only for as long as necessary to fulfill the purposes for which it was collected, or as required by applicable law:
- Account data: Retained for the duration of your account plus 6 months after account deletion or termination.
- Transaction records & invoices: Retained for a minimum of 8 years as required under the Income Tax Act, 1961 and GST regulations.
- KYC documents: Retained for 5 years after the end of the business relationship, in line with regulatory requirements.
- Usage logs & analytics: Retained in anonymized/aggregated form for up to 3 years for platform improvement.
- Communication records: Retained for 2 years for support and dispute resolution purposes.
After the applicable retention period, data is securely deleted or irreversibly anonymized.

9. Your Rights (Data Principal Rights)
Under the DPDP Act, 2023 and applicable data protection laws, you have the following rights:
- Right to Access: Request confirmation of whether we process your personal data and obtain a summary of such data.
- Right to Correction: Request correction of inaccurate, incomplete, or misleading personal data.
- Right to Erasure: Request deletion of your personal data, subject to legal and contractual retention obligations.
- Right to Withdraw Consent: Withdraw consent for processing at any time. Note that withdrawal of consent does not affect the lawfulness of processing based on consent before withdrawal, and may result in discontinuation of certain services.
- Right to Nominate: Nominate any other individual to exercise your rights in the event of your death or incapacity, as provided under the DPDP Act.
- Right to Grievance Redressal: File a complaint regarding our data processing practices with our Grievance Officer or, if unsatisfied, with the Data Protection Board of India.
